摘要
以填充墙与框架结构共同作用为机理,通过分析在水平力作用下砖砌体填充墙—框架结构体系的自振周期,探讨填充墙对框架结构自振周期的影响程度及其规律,结果表明填充墙—框架结构体系的自振周期低于纯框架结构,有的甚至超出了设计常用修正值;在工程设计中应考虑填充墙对框架结构自振周期的影响,使框架结构在地震作用下的计算结果更切合实际,以提高结构设计的安全性与经济性。
Based on interaction of filling wall and frame structure, the self-vibration period of filling wall and frame structure has been analyzed under horizontal load and the influence extent of filling wall on self-vibration period of frame structure. It is revealed that the self-vibration period of filling wall and frame structure has decreased a little to simple frame structure. It has been pointed out that in the engineering design, the influence of filling wall should be taken into account, so that the computing of frame under earthquake is more accordant with the fact and the design is more safe and economic.
